New feed-in tariffs to boost UK solar industry after May drop off

New feed-in tariffs (FiTs) will boost the United Kingdom’s solar industry following a government turnaround on the controversial subsidies. The Conservative UK government scrapped the nation’s previous FiT scheme in April this year, leading to a rapid downturn in new solar installations. Overdue federal report shows rising greenhouse gas emissions put Paris climate target in jeopardy
The overdue quarterly update of Australia’s greenhouse gases shows rising emissions will make it hard to meet our Paris Agreement obligations. Released five days after its due date, the Quarterly Update of Australia’s National Greenhouse Gas Inventory reveals a 0.7 per cent overall increase in carbon emissions over the previous year. Nation’s top solar university commits to 100% renewable energy
The nation’s top solar university research hub, the University of New South Wales (UNSW), in Sydney, has announced it will switch to 100 per cent renewable energy by 2020. Car giants Jaguar Land Rover and BMW team up to develop new electric vehicles

UK car manufacturer Jaguar Land Rover has partnered with German-based BMW to develop new electric vehicles and technology. The companies say they will reduce cost by sharing research and production planning for a new breed of EVs. The BBC reports they will also share the costs of buying car components. Adelaide office tower scores state’s first 6 star NABERS Energy rating

An Adelaide office tower claims to be South Australia’s first 6 star NABERS Energy rated building. The building at 50 Flinders Street is also the first to get a NABERS Indoor Environment rating, according to developers. Reported by The Fifth Estate, the building originally had a 5 star rating.
